As an Outpatient Physical Therapist, you will play a vital role in our clinical team, working with patients to help them achieve their full potential through innovative and personalized therapy.
Your Responsibilities
- Provide skilled clinical services using standard of care, evidence-based practices, and outcomes-based approaches.
- Maintain effective communication and relationships with peers, patients, families, caregivers, and stakeholders.
- Participate in mentoring and supervision of students and new hires.
-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ives as part of the Intermountain Operating Model.
- Promote our mission, vision, and values by upholding service standards.
Qualifications
- Master's Degree in Physical Therapy or equivalent.
- Current licensure in state of practice.
- Current BLS certification endorsed by the American Heart Association.
- Basic computer skills.
-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ills.
- Experience with target population of the job setting.
